Pest Pressures in Devington

What 38th Street operators actually face.

Pest pressure specific to the Devington commercial corridor — what we see on service calls, by venue type.

Norway Rats & House Mice
High
Gas-station dumpster corrals, 38th Street strip back alleys, c-store back rooms

Dumpster corrals at gas stations, c-stores, and restaurant strip-mall back alleys are the single biggest rodent draw on the corridor. Exterior station programs with corral-adjacent bait boxes paired with dock-sweep repairs on back doors breaks that pressure.

German Cockroaches
High
38th Street strip retail, older restaurant kitchens, walk-up multifamily

38th Street strip retail tenants share mechanical walls and plumbing chases. When one tenant falls behind on service, German roaches migrate across the wall to the next. Coordinated cross-tenant treatment is how we actually end cascades — national chains just treat the complaining unit.

Bed Bugs
High
Walk-up multifamily, social-service shelters, community housing

Walk-up apartments and shelters along the corridor face constant bed bug reintroduction through resident belongings. Aprehend® lets us treat without displacing residents — critical for operators who can't afford unit downtime or resident relocation.

Pharaoh Ants
High
Sherman & Arlington healthcare clinics, urgent care, dental offices

Pharaoh ants in Devington clinics require non-repellent bait protocols. We regularly inherit accounts where the previous company used contact spray — which fragments pharaoh colonies and actually multiplies the problem. Correct baiting clears the colony.

House Flies & Fruit Flies
Medium
Restaurant trash corrals, auto-repair dumpsters, gas-station food-prep

Auto-repair bay doors and food-service dumpsters are a perfect fly-breeding environment (oil rags, food waste, open-door access). Source treatment at the dumpster paired with ILT networks at service counters beats adult knockdown.

Odorous House Ants
Medium
Retail strip breakrooms, walk-up multifamily kitchens, daycare

Odorous house ants form supercolonies — wrong product (repellent sprays) fragments them and makes things worse. Non-repellent baiting actually clears the colony.

Drain Flies
Medium
Restaurant kitchens, bar wellpipes, clinic mop sinks, gas-station food-prep

Drain fly biofilm is the #1 fly call we get from Devington restaurants. Brush-and-foam treatment on the actual floor drain is the only thing that ends the cycle.

Devington Pest Calendar

Devington's pest calendar runs rodent-heavy October through February as populations push indoors off back-alley dumpsters and gas-station corrals, German roach pressure stays year-round in the shared-wall strip retail and older restaurant kitchens, bed bug activity at walk-up multifamily and shelters runs steady all year with spikes in late spring and early fall, fly pressure at restaurants and auto-repair spikes June through September, pharaoh ants in clinics peak May through September, and rooftop bird nesting peaks March through July. Planning service against that rhythm is how we keep Devington operators ahead of issues — not reacting to them.

Our 38th Street strip retail has German roaches moving between tenants — how do you handle that?
Shared-wall strip retail cascades are one of the most common Devington accounts we take over from national chains. Adjacent tenants share mechanical walls, plumbing chases, and often HVAC runs — German roaches migrate through those voids when one tenant falls behind on sanitation or service. Our approach is cross-tenant coordination: we talk to the property manager or landlord, get consent to treat adjacent units in sequence, use gel baiting and IGRs (not broadcast spray, which just scatters the colony), and install monitors in the shared chases themselves. Most strip-retail cascades we inherit are cleared in 4–6 weeks with coordinated treatment.
Can you treat pharaoh ants in a Devington clinic correctly? The last company made it worse.
Yes — and unfortunately what you described is common. Pharaoh ants are a social-insect colony that responds to non-repellent baits. When a pest company uses contact spray or repellent products, workers get separated from the queens, colonies fragment, and what was one colony becomes several satellite outbreaks. The correct approach is labeled non-repellent gel and liquid bait, placed in voids and runways (out of patient and staff contact), letting workers carry active ingredient back to queens. Colonies collapse in 2–4 weeks. We use this protocol at every clinic and healthcare account along Sherman, Arlington, and 38th.
Do you service gas stations and c-stores on 38th, Sherman, and Arlington?
Yes — gas stations and c-stores are one of our primary Devington account types. Programs typically include exterior rodent stations around the fueling canopy and dumpster corral, dock-sweep inspection on back-of-house doors, interior monitors on the perimeter wall, drain-fly treatment in food-prep areas, and fly-control (ILTs) at the service counter if food is prepared on-site. Service works around your 24/7 operating reality — we can schedule pre-dawn or off-peak visits so customer traffic isn't disrupted. Documentation is ready for Marion County Public Health Department inspections on food-prep operations.
How do you handle fly pressure at a Devington auto-repair shop?
Auto-repair shops have a specific fly profile because of open bay doors, oil-rag dumpsters, and food-trash mixed into main dumpsters. House flies and blow flies breed in that organic load and then walk through the open bays all summer. Our approach is source elimination first: we re-engineer dumpster placement if it's too close to the main bay, work with you on oil-rag storage (covered containers, more frequent rotation), and install ILTs in the customer waiting area and cashier station where flies draw toward light. Perimeter treatment on the building envelope handles the walking-in pressure from adjacent harborage. Most auto-shop fly issues are cleared in 2–3 service cycles.
Do you work with social-service and shelter operators in the neighborhood?
Yes. Social-service providers, shelters, food-pantry operators, and community-health facilities in Devington face constant bed bug reintroduction through client belongings — and the standard bed bug protocol of heat treatment or chemical spray plus bag-and-launder is impractical when clients can't be displaced. Aprehend® is exactly the tool for this environment. We treat baseboards, bed frames, and harborage with a thin residual band of EPA-registered biopesticide. Bed bugs walk through, contract the fungus, and die over 5–10 days — including eggs that hatch into the treated band. Clients stay on-site, no displacement, no furniture removal, no bag-and-launder operation.

How do you handle bed bugs in Devington walk-up apartment buildings without displacing residents?
Aprehend® is the protocol. We apply a thin, near-invisible biopesticide band along baseboards, door frames, bed frames, and harborage points throughout the unit and common-area transitions (hallway baseboards, stairwell edges). Bed bugs walk through the band, pick up fungal spores, and die over 5–10 days. Eggs that hatch into the treated band also die. Residents stay in the unit, furniture stays in place, and the band keeps killing for up to 3 months. For a walk-up portfolio where one unit's bed bug complaint used to turn into a $1,500 heat treatment and a displaced resident, Aprehend® is a completely different economics model.
